Q. The mean of a set of observations is $\bar{x}$. If each observation is divided by $\alpha,(\alpha \neq 0)$ and then is increased by $10$ , then the mean of the new set is

Statistics

Solution:

Let the set of $n$ observations $x _1, x _2, \ldots \ldots x _{ n }$
$\therefore \quad \overline{ x } =\frac{\Sigma x _1}{ n }$
Mean of new set $=\frac{\Sigma\left(\frac{ x _1}{\alpha}+10\right)}{ n }=\frac{1}{\alpha} \frac{\sum x _1}{ n }+\frac{10 n }{ n }=\frac{\overline{ x }+10 \alpha}{\alpha}$
